FAQs for booking London to Islamabad flights

  • Is there a car hire centre at Islamabad Airport?

    No, there is no dedicated car hire centre at Islamabad Airport. However, there are car hire agencies such as SIXT and Avis, which operate from off-site locations. These offer meet-and-greet services at the International Arrivals hall for passengers who have made advance reservations.

  • Where can I get some local currency at Islamabad Airport?

    If you can’t find an ATM at the International Arrivals hall or on the main concourse at Islamabad Airport, there is a Banking Square near the main parking garage. Several banks, including the National Bank of Pakistan, MCB Bank, and Allied Bank Limited, maintain offices there for your convenience. You can make currency exchange transactions and conduct other financial arrangements.

  • Is there a medical facility at Islamabad Airport?

    If you or another passenger sustains an injury or needs emergency assistance while at Islamabad Airport, there is an on-site medical facility with trained staff where you can receive treatment. The MI Room is on Level 1 of the Passenger Terminal Building, and is open 24h a day, 7 days a week, for passengers’ convenience.

  • What are some other cities or regions served by Islamabad Airport?

    Islamabad Airport is the main air hub serving the Islamabad–Rawalpindi metropolitan area of northern Punjab province, and the Islamabad Capital Territory in Pakistan. Its proximity to the border of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province also puts you within striking distance of Peshawar (113 miles).

Top tips for finding a cheap flight from London to Islamabad

  • London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is the biggest and busiest airport of those serving the Greater London metropolitan area. British Airways, the UK flagship carrier, operates an air hub at London Heathrow Airport and offers several direct flights from there to Islamabad International Airport (ISB) in Pakistan.
  • If you prefer to drive and fly instead of using public transportation, there are several parking options at London Heathrow Airport to suit your needs. Multi-storey short-stay parking close to the terminals starts at about £5.10 per hour. Long-stay parking offers free shuttle bus transfers to the terminals as well as attractive rates if you book a space online.
  • If you’ve got some time to kill or your flight has been delayed, visit one of London Heathrow’s airport lounges for a spot of relaxation and the opportunity to charge your devices and enjoy some complimentary food and beverages. The Club Aspire Lounge is located at Gate 18 (after security), on Level 2 of Terminal 5, while the Plaza Premium Lounge is located at Gate 16 (after security), on Level 4 of Terminal 2.
  • Business travellers or large groups flying together should know there are a few meeting rooms you can reserve at London Heathrow Airport. Regus operates a drop-in business lounge at Terminal 3 with workspaces and showers, as well as regular rooms in Terminals 2 and 4 (in conjunction with Plaza Premium Lounge) and also at Terminal 5.
  • Whether you’re a frequent flyer or not, the London Heathrow Airport app is a handy piece of kit for keeping abreast of live flight data without having to find a tracking board. It can also help you to navigate the various airport terminals if you need services or facilities, and provides information on discounts or special offers by participating stores and restaurants.
